Guyanese Pride Vermicelli Noodles, Fine 10oz (No Eggs)
This is a traditional Guyanese Muslim sweet. It's called vermicelli, after the noodles used to make it. It's a a mixture of vermicelli and milk and sugar that's sort of congealed.
Trinis don't make this very often, but call it sawine cake, because our Muslim sweet using the vermicelli noodles is called sawine (we call the noodles sawine), and it's made into a soup/drink. The noodles are "parched" (browned) and swim in sweet spiced milk (a little like this Pakistani vermicelli), with nuts and raisins (optional for some of us).
